Saw an interesting news report on Channel U/8 (either one of them). Finally have sometime (after a “big” morning) to do a quick search on the net, and found the relevant reports.

“Swans have long been renowned as symbols of lifelong fidelity and devotion, but our recent work has shown that infidelity is rife among black swans,� says Dr Raoul Mulder from the University of Melbourne’s Department of Zoology.

According to the report, 1 out of 6 baby swan are found “illegitimate” by DNA paternity analysis. (meaning they are ç§?生å­? or their mother æ?žå¤–é?‡ la.)

If my memory didn’t fail me, the news report also said that female black swans normally sneak out between 11pm and 3am.
